Lead RN Case Manager – Discharge Planning

Location: Holy Cross Health | Silver Spring, MD

Employment Type: Full - Time

Position Purpose

Holy Cross Health is seeking a Lead RN Case Manager to oversee discharge planning efforts and serve as the senior clinical resource within our Case Management department. This role partners with leadership to develop and implement best practices that enhance patient care, ensure compliance, and support successful transitions from hospital to home or other care settings.

What You Will Do

  • Lead and mentor case managers with a focus on effective, patient-centered discharge planning
  • Oversee orientation and ongoing competency development for case management staff
  • Support quality improvement initiatives and clinical documentation integrity
  • Collaborate with interdisciplinary teams to remove discharge barriers and optimize care transitions
  • Act as a resource for complex case reviews and regulatory compliance
  • Promote consistent communication with medical staff, nursing, and ancillary departments

Minimum Qualifications

  • RN licensed in Maryland
  • BSN required; Master’s degree or Case Management certification preferred
  • Minimum two years of hospital-based case management experience, including exposure to quality improvement and documentation review
  • Strong communication, leadership, and interpersonal skills
  • Knowledge of hospital reimbursement and regulatory guidelines
  • Proficiency in clinical systems and data analysis

Ministry/Facility Information

Holy Cross Health is a Catholic, not-for-profit health system that serves the two most populous counties in Maryland, Montgomery and Prince George’s, with a commitment to being the most trusted provider of health-care services in the area. Founded in 1963 by the Sisters of the Holy Cross, Holy Cross Health is a member of Trinity Health of Livonia, Michigan. Holy Cross Hospital, in Silver Spring, is one of the largest hospitals in Maryland, and Holy Cross Germantown Hospital is the first hospital in the nation built on a community college campus, enhanced by an educational partnership. The Holy Cross Health Network operates primary-care practices and affordable health centers, and offers a wide range of innovative, community-based health and wellness programs. Specialty care, home care and hospice services round out Holy Cross Health’s high-quality and coordinated continuum of care that aims to improve health and let you live life on your own terms.
